About The Position

Join Barclays as a Business Manager Research, AVP, where you will help drive the strategy, governance, and operational excellence behind AI, data, and quantitative research. You will support the onboarding and coordination of external AI and data vendors, partner with Data Science and Quantitative teams to oversee proof-of-concept programs, and advocate for the infrastructure that enables research innovation. Your role will also involve supporting the development and guidance of structured data products, organizing research outputs such as models, signals, and datasets, and ensuring robust oversight of data usage, entitlements, and client access. As well as, working across a broad stakeholder network, you will help ensure that research data and insights are governed, packaged, and distributed efficiently to maximize business impact.
